2017-01-31 1 views
1

Ich schreibe eine Azure-Funktion (HttpTrigger - C#), die einige Anweisungen enthält, die in Azure SQL Server eingefügt werden. Ich folgte diesem Tutorial.Azure-Funktion von (HttpTrigger - C#) in Azure Logic App verwenden

Ich möchte es in Azure Logic App verwenden. Aber es erlaubt nicht, diese Art von Funktion als eine Aktion hinzuzufügen. Azure Logic App ermöglicht nur das Hinzufügen von Funktionen des Typs "Generischer Webhook". Datenbankunterstützung ist jedoch in den Funktionen vom Typ (HttpTrigger - C#) verfügbar. Gibt es eine Möglichkeit, (HttpTrigger - C#) von einer anderen Funktion aufzurufen, die bereits in Azure Logic App hinzugefügt wurde.

Gibt es einen anderen besseren Weg, um es zu erreichen?

+0

Wenn Ihre azure-Funktion App eine generische Webhook-App ist, können Sie sie über die Logik-App aufrufen. Funktionen, die diese Vorlagen verwenden, werden automatisch erkannt und im Logic Apps-Designer unter Azure-Funktionen in meiner Region aufgelistet.Oder wenn es in Ordnung ist Um eine Verbindung zur Datenbank herzustellen und Daten von der Logik-App selbst einzufügen, können Sie den SQL-Connector für logische Anwendungen ausprobieren. – Aravind

Antwort

3

Sie sollten den Modus zu Webhook und den Webhook-Typ zu generischem JSON für Ihre Funktion ändern können.

Die Kommunikation mit SQL Azure ist nicht auf Funktionen beschränkt, die HTTP-Trigger verwenden. Sie sollten also im Wesentlichen die gleiche Logik verwenden und die Funktion so bereitstellen können, dass sie problemlos von Logic Apps verwendet werden kann.

1

Wir arbeiten an der Unterstützung von HTTPTrigger-Typ-Funktionen, sollte es in Kürze verfügbar sein. In der Zwischenzeit sollten Sie die HTTP-Aktion zum Auslösen dieser Funktionen verwenden können. Bei dieser Problemumgehung müssen Sie die Authentifizierung selbst durchführen.

Verwandte Themen